LARGO – Largo police are asking the public’s help in identifying a couple suspected of taking a wallet full of cash and gift cards Feb. 8 at Five Guys and Fries.
The reported theft occurred about 1:30 p.m. at the restaurant at 13680 Walsingham Road. The wallet was later found and turned over to police, without the cash and gift cards the victim said were stashed inside.
Both suspects – one male, one female – are described as white and between 45 and 55 years old. The woman was said to be between 5 feet 5 inches and 5 feet 7 inches tall, weighing between 130 and 140 pounds. The man is described as around 3 inches taller and weighing about 170 and 180 pounds.
Anyone with information is asked to call Detective Christopher Keeler of the Largo Police Department's investigative services division at 586-7475.
